System Administrator Jobs in Peoria, IL
A System Administrator, commonly referred to as a SysAdmin, is an essential figure in the technology industry, primarily responsible for setting up and maintaining an organization's computer systems. They ensure that the systems are running smoothly and effectively, which includes the necessary software updates, system installations, implementing and maintaining system security measures, troubleshooting problems, and providing technical support. Additionally, System Administrators may also be responsible for managing the network infrastructure, which includes routers, switches, firewalls, and other equipment.
To become a competent System Administrator, several skills are necessary. These include proficiency in operating systems, scripting, networking, security, and troubleshooting. Familiarity with database management, cloud computing, and virtualization are also advantageous. A System Administrator should have a good understanding of many, if not all, aspects of an IT system. Some of the most recognized certifications for System Administrators include Microsoft Certified: Azure Administrator Associate, Red Hat Certified System Administrator (RHCSA), CompTIA A+, and Network+. Prior to becoming a System Administrator, an individual might have roles such as Help Desk Technician, Network Support Specialist, or IT Analyst. These roles provide the foundational knowledge and experience needed for a successful career as a System Administrator.
